Montrose Air Station Heritage Trust
Montrose Air Station Heritage Trust is a registered charity in Scotland working in the advancement of education, the advancement of citizenship or community development, the advancement of the arts, heritage, culture or science, based in Angus.

What the charity does
To establish and maintain a museum for the benefit of the public, to house protect, and maintain into the future such artifacts which make up the collection of aircraft, documents, books, photographs, uniforms, medals, instruments, and other material/artifacts as exist from the Royal Flying Corps and Royal Air Force squadrons stationed at Montrose between the periods 1913 to 1952, plus squadrons with a close association with Montrose as well as the RAF in Scotland since 1913 to the present day.
